PRODUCTOS Y COCIENTES NOTABLES
PRODUCTOS Y COCIENTES NOTABLES
- Ejercicio 64
Escribir, por simple inspección, el resultado de:
- ( x+y ) ( x–y ) = x 2 – y 2
- ( m–n ) ( m+n ) = m 2 – n 2
- ( a–x ) ( x+a ) =( a–x ) ( a+x ) = a 2 – x 2
- ( x 2 + a 2 ) ( x 2 – a 2 ) = ( x 2 ) 2 – ( a 2 ) 2 = x 4 – a 4
- ( 2a–1 ) ( 1+2a ) =( 2a–1 ) ( 2a+1 ) = ( 2a ) 2 – ( 1 ) 2 =4 a 2 –1
- ( n–1 ) ( n+1 ) = n 2 –1
- ( 1–3ax ) ( 3ax+1 ) =( 1–3ax ) ( 1+3ax ) =1–9 a 2 x 2
- ( 2m+9 ) ( 2m–9 ) = ( 2m ) 2 – ( 9 ) 2 =4 m 2 –81
- ( a 3 – b 2 ) ( a 3 + b 2 ) = ( a 3 ) 2 – ( b 2 ) 2 = a 6 – b 4
- ( y 2 –3y ) ( y 2 +3y ) = ( y 2 ) 2 – ( 3y ) 2 = y 4 –9 y 2
- ( 1–8xy ) ( 8xy+1 ) =( 1–8xy ) ( 1+8xy ) = 1 2 – ( 8xy ) 2 =1–64 x 2 y 2
- ( 6 x 2 – m 2 x ) ( 6 x 2 + m 2 x ) = ( 6 x 2 ) 2 – ( m 2 x ) 2 =36 x 4 – m 4 x 2
- ( a m + b n ) ( a m – b n ) = ( a m ) 2 – ( b n ) 2 = a 2m – b 2n
- ( 3 x a –5 y m ) ( 5 y m +3 x a ) =( 3 x a –5 y m ) ( 3 x a +5 y m ) = ( 3 x a ) 2 – ( 5 y m ) 2 =9 x 2a –25 y 2m
- ( a x+1 –2 b x–1 ) ( 2 b x–1 + a x+1 ) =( a x+1 –2 b x–1 ) ( a x+1 +2 b x–1 ) = ( a x+1 ) 2 – ( 2 b x–1 ) 2 = a 2x+2 –4 b 2x–2
